    Abstract: A connector includes a housing, a holder, and a short-circuiting terminal. The holder is non-movable to a formal locking position when terminals, which are short-circuiting targets, are not inserted into a terminal receiving chamber. The holder is movable to the formal locking position when the terminals, which are short-circuiting targets, are inserted into a sufficient insertion position of the terminal receiving chamber. A contact member of the short-circuiting terminal is in contact with the terminals, which are short-circuiting targets, and the terminals, which are short-circuiting targets, are short-circuited when the terminals, which are short-circuiting terminals, are inserted into the sufficient insertion position and the holder is moved to the formal locking position.

    Abstract: The connector housing includes: the terminal reception chambers, the terminal insertion holes; the lock portions; and the coupling portion connecting a pair of the lock portions each belonging to each of a pair of the terminal reception chambers located adjacent to each other. The coupling portion is connected to a first partition wall partitioning a pair of the terminal insertion holes corresponding to the pair of the terminal reception chambers. The coupling portion has a groove extending along a direction to receive the each terminal.

    Abstract: A connector includes: a housing; and a short-circuit terminal. A deformable portion is configured to deform in a direction of moving away from the terminal during housing of the terminal and to deform in a direction of moving closer to the terminal when the housing of the terminal is finished. The short-circuit terminal has, as different portions, a contact point portion to contact with the two or more terminals and a push target portion to contact with the deformable portion. The short-circuit terminal is configured to reduce its pressure of contact toward the terminal at the contact point portion, during the housing of the terminal, due to a movement of the push target portion along with the deformable portion.

    Abstract: A connector includes: a housing; and a detector detecting whether a terminal is received at a regular position. The locking portion has an abutment part to lock the terminal, and an interference part interfering with the detector to prevent the detector from being assembled to the housing. The abutment part is displaced to lock the terminal at the regular position when the terminal is at the regular position, and to leave the terminal when the terminal is not at the regular position. The interference part moves along with the abutment part to a position not to interfere with the detector when the terminal is at the regular position, and to be displaced to a position to interfere with the detector when terminal is not at the regular position.

    Abstract: A terminal removal jig includes a jig body including a release pin configured to release a terminal from being locked by a lance provided in a connector housing, and an attachment configured to be detachably attached to the jig body and to guide the release pin toward the lance by coming into contact at least a part of the attachment with an inner wall of the connector housing when the release pin is inserted into the connector housing. The attachment is attached to the jig body so as to be movable between a first position in the jig body and a second position located on a tip end side of the jig body relative to the first position, and includes a lock portion configured to lock the attachment to the jig body when the attachment is in the second position.

    Abstract: This connector housing includes a housing body, terminal accommodating chambers provided, in the housing body, in a plurality of stages in the vertical direction; and lances for locking a terminal when the terminal is inserted from the rear into a terminal accommodating chamber. The lances are provided on the lower side in the upper terminal accommodating chamber and on the upper side in the lower terminal accommodating chamber, and are provided at a distance from each other in the lateral direction when viewed from above.

    Abstract: One of a pair of connectors of a spring type connector includes an inner housing, an outer housing, a gap defined between the inner housing and the outer housing, retaining mechanisms, and a spring. The retaining mechanism includes a pair of abutting members provided on the inner housing and the outer housing, and a cushioning member provided between the pair of the abutting members.

    Abstract: There is provided a waterproof connector structure which includes a pair of connector housings. An opening end portion of a cylindrical body of one connector housing is inserted into an opening end portion of a cylindrical body of another connector housing at the time of fitting. One cylindrical body has a projection part which is provided to protrude outward in a radial direction from the opening end portion thereof entirely in a circumferential direction. The projection part is provided on a front side in a fitting direction from an opening part of a terminal receiving chamber surrounded by the one cylindrical body.

    Abstract: The connector includes an inner housing, an outer housing, a locking mechanism for locking, a spring member that pushes back the inner housing during half fitting, and a pushback regulating position that regulates a pushback position. The pushback regulating portion includes a claw portion, a stepped portion against which the claw portion abuts, and a sliding load portion that makes a sliding friction force between the inner housing and the outer housing at a predetermined timing before abutting to be larger than the sliding friction force before the predetermined timing.

    Abstract: A connector includes: a first connector which includes a tubular outer housing and an inner housing in which a plurality of first terminals are provided; a second connector which includes a bottomed tubular counterpart housing in which a plurality of second terminals are provided; and an elastic member which is provided in the outer housing and urges the inner housing toward a front side of the first connector in a fitting direction. The inner housing is moved by the elastic member to the front side in the fitting direction at the time of fitting.

    Abstract: One of a pair of first terminals includes a spring member of which one end is supported by the first housing. A contact portion that contacts one of a pair of second terminals is formed on a free end of the spring member. A lock arm abuts against the spring member to displace the contact portion, and brings the contact portion into contact with one of the second terminals at the time of locking. The other of the first terminals has a contact portion that contacts the other of the second terminals when the connectors are fitted, and is disposed apart from one of the first terminals.

    Abstract: A meter device is disposed on an upper surface of a fuel tank that is disposed between a steering handlebar and a rider's seat. The meter device includes a dial substrate having a scale and a pointer that is rotated by a drive portion and points to the scale corresponding to a measurement output. The pointer includes a ridge that extends in a longitudinal direction and a spine portion having two surfaces that cross each other so as to form the ridge. An angle ?, at which the two surfaces forming the ridge cross each other, is formed into an acute angle, so that a side farther from the ridge as viewed from a side of a rider is not visible.
